Workflow automation connects triggers, approvals, and data moves across tools so repetitive process work runs without copy-paste. Combining classical automation with AI is when Zar Labs typically creates the most leverage.
Manual status updates, lead routing, and report assembly waste skilled time and introduce errors. Automation encodes the process once.
